Method
- Marinate the Chicken: In a medium mixing bowl, whisk together olive oil, melted butter, minced garlic, grated parmesan, oregano, parsley, salt, pepper, and red pepper flakes (if using). Add the chicken cubes to the marinade and toss to coat. Let the chicken marinate for at least 15 minutes, but you can marinate it longer for extra flavor.
- Prepare the Skewers: While the chicken is marinating, thread the chicken cubes onto your soaked skewers. Make sure to leave a little space between each piece to ensure even cooking.
- Preheat the Grill: Preheat your grill or grill pan to medium-high heat. If you’re using a grill pan, lightly oil it to prevent the chicken from sticking.
- Grill the Skewers: Place the skewers on the grill and cook for 10-12 minutes, turning occasionally until the chicken is golden brown and fully cooked. Make sure to baste the skewers with the leftover marinade every few minutes to keep the chicken moist and flavorful.
- Serve: Once the chicken is cooked, remove the skewers from the grill and let them rest for a couple of minutes. Sprinkle freshly chopped parsley on top for a burst of colour and freshness.
Notes
For the juiciest chicken skewers, make sure to marinate the chicken for at least 15 minutes, but if you have more time, marinate it for up to an hour. This allows the flavors to really soak into the chicken, making every bite burst with taste. Don't skip the basting during grilling; it helps to keep the chicken tender and gives it that extra garlic parmesan flavour.
